The Bahrain Grand Prix Drew the Second-Largest U.S. Audience for an F1 Race Ever

ESPN the record Tuesday, saying an average of 711,000 viewers watched the ESPN2 telecast Sunday. The announcement said that made it the largest U.S. television audience on record for Bahrain,which , and that it was the second-largest U.S. cable audience for an F1 race on record. The only telecast to beat it, the announcement said, was the Monaco Grand Prix on ESPN last year, which had an average of 820,000 .

The number from Sunday is also up from an average of 692,000 viewers for the Bahrain race on the same channel last year, according to ESPN, and up from the 413,000 who watched on CNBC in 2017. Not only were the numbers from the Bahrain telecast up this year, but ESPN’s announcement said viewership of the season-opening Australian Grand Prix was up as well—from 175,000 watching on ESPN2 in 2018 to 659,000 this year. A 277-percent audience increase for an event that started at 1 a.m. ET isn’t terrible.

Higher viewership is always good, but those numbers are nothing to put on a T-shirt when compared to numbers for series like NASCAR and IndyCar.
